Original Description
Jules Merckaert's La Table Dressee (The Set Table) is a captivating example of late 19th-century still life painting that exudes warmth and quiet elegance. The composition features a meticulously arranged table laden with sumptuous fruits, gleaming glassware, and delicate fabrics, rendered in Merckaert’s signature realist style infused with Impressionist light. The interplay of textures—soft folds of linen, reflective surfaces, and ripe, tactile fruit—creates a sensory feast, while the warm, golden tones evoke intimacy and abundance. Painted during Belgium’s artistic flourishing, Merckaert’s work reflects the period’s fascination with domestic beauty and the symbolic richness of still life. Though less widely known than French masters like Chardin or Manet, La Table Dressee exemplifies the Northern European tradition of precision and luminosity, bridging realism and emerging modernism.
